package repicea.simulation;
public interface MonteCarloSimulationCompliantObject {
/**
* This method returns an object that makes it possible to identify
* the subject that implements this interface. This id remains constant
* throughout the Monte Carlo iterations in case of stochastic implementation.
* @return a String that defines the subject id and that remains constant throughout the simulation
*/
public String getSubjectId();
/**
* This method returns the hierarchical levels of the object.
* @return a HierarchicalLevel instance
*/
public HierarchicalLevel getHierarchicalLevel();
// /**
// * This method sets the MonteCarlo id of the subject. Some instances might have a different implementation of this and might not have to use this method.
// * @param i the MonteCarlo id
// */
// public void setMonteCarloRealizationId(int i);
/**
* This method returns the id of the Monte Carlo realization. It is necessary for the implementation
* of the random deviates on the parameter estimates. These deviates remain constant for a particular
* Monte Carlo iteration, regardless of the plot.
* @return an integer
*/
public int getMonteCarloRealizationId();
}
